Being in Kerala is bliss; absolutely safe to visit: Virat Kohli

Team India is playing an ODI in Thiruvananthapuram after a long gap, and the teams have landed in the Kerala capital today afternoon to a grand welcome. After receiving the grand ceremonial welcome with traditional drums (Chenda melam), Virat Kohli and Co. are now at the Leela Raviz Kovalam, which provides a breath-taking view of the Arabian sea.

The Indian caption is all praise for the God’s own Country and its beauty and hospitality. “Being in Kerala is nothing short of bliss. I love coming here and love the energy of the whole place. The beauty of Kerala is something to be experienced and I would recommend to everyone that they come here and experience the energy of God’s own Country. Kerala is surely back to its feet and absolutely safe to come to. Thanks to this amazing place for making me feel happy everytime I am here,” noted Virat Kohli in the visitors book at the Leela Raviz.

The team was received in the capital city of Kerala by huge number of fans. The Leela Raviz Kovalam, built by world-renowned architect Charles Correa, have prepared a special menu for the Indian team which provides a real taste of Kerala cuisine in all its richness. “We have got a huge collection of a variety of seafood which includes prawns, crabs and fish, especially, pearl spot- a traditional delicacy of our state, that has been sourced from a few places,” said R Sreejith, Senior Manager of the hotel.

India and West Indies will play the fifth and final ODI on November 1 at the Greenfield International Stadium in Thiruvananthapuram. Team India landed  after decimating West Indies in the fourth ODI in Mumbai, with a lead of 2-1 in the five-match ODI series against West Indies. The Men in Blue have to avoid a defeat at the Green Park stadium on Thursday to clinch the series.
